Canonical shape
One row, in the required order
The short fields identify the row. Put operational detail in Instructions.
## Section: Readiness
### Procedure: Work area condition
- Action: Inspect work area
- Spec: Clear and accessible
- Result:
- Status:
- Comment:
#### Instructions
Confirm the area is ready for the planned task.
#### Relationships
